Overview
This article explores the application of causal inference methods at Uber to enhance user experience by understanding the underlying causes of user behavior. It discusses various methodologies, their importance, and future directions for implementing these techniques in product development and data analysis.
What You'll Learn
1
How to apply causal inference methods to improve user experience
2
Why understanding causal relationships is crucial for product development
3
When to use observational data for causal inference analysis
Prerequisites & Requirements
- Basic understanding of statistical methods and causal relationships
- Familiarity with data analysis tools and platforms used at Uber(optional)
Key Questions Answered
What is causal inference and how is it used at Uber?
Causal inference is a set of statistical methods aimed at determining the cause-and-effect relationships between variables. At Uber, these methods help teams analyze user behavior and improve the customer experience by providing insights into the effectiveness of product features and services.
Why is causal inference important for improving user experience?
Causal inference helps identify customer pain points and informs product development decisions. By understanding the causes behind user behavior, Uber can tailor its services to better meet customer needs, leading to enhanced satisfaction and engagement.
How does Uber apply causal inference with experimental data?
Uber utilizes randomized controlled experiments to establish causal relationships and estimate treatment effects. These experiments provide clear insights into how changes in features or services impact user behavior, allowing for data-driven decision-making.
What challenges does Uber face when using observational data for causal inference?
Using observational data can introduce biases due to confounding variables that affect the outcome. Uber must carefully control for these variables to ensure accurate estimates of causal effects, which can be complex and require substantial domain knowledge.
Key Actionable Insights
1Implementing causal inference methods can significantly enhance product development decisions by providing deeper insights into user behavior.By understanding the causal relationships behind user actions, teams can prioritize features that address specific pain points, ultimately improving user satisfaction and retention.
2Utilizing observational data effectively requires careful consideration of confounding variables to avoid biased results.Uber's analysts must collaborate closely with domain experts to identify relevant variables and ensure accurate causal modeling, which is crucial for making informed business decisions.
3Causal inference methods can be integrated into existing data analysis platforms to streamline the process of deriving insights.By building these methodologies into tools used across the company, Uber can empower teams to leverage causal analysis in their everyday work, enhancing overall efficiency.
Common Pitfalls
1
Failing to account for confounding variables can lead to misleading conclusions about causal relationships.
This often occurs when analysts do not have a comprehensive understanding of the data or the underlying business context, which can skew results and impact decision-making.